The traditional 2D ultrasound generates flat and described pictures which can be utilized to see your infant's internal organs and aid find any internal concerns. These black and white pictures help the sonographer figure out the baby's pregnancy, growth, heartbeat, growth and dimension. Some expectant mothers choose to have a 3D ultrasound check since they reveal even more of a real-life photo of the infant.

3D ultrasound scans show still pictures of your baby's outside body as opposed to their withins, so you can see the shape of the child's face functions. 4D ultrasound scans are similar to 3D scans but they show a moving video as opposed to still images. This captures highlights and shadows better, therefore producing a more clear photo of the infant's face and movements.

A prenatal ultrasound check is a diagnostic method that uses high-frequency acoustic waves to produce an image of your unborn child. Ultrasounds may be performed at different times throughout pregnancy for various reasons. The examination can offer beneficial info, helping females and their health-care service providers manage and look after the pregnancy and the unborn child.
A transducer is put into the vaginal area and rests against the rear of the vaginal area to produce a picture. A transvaginal ultrasound produces a sharper picture and is frequently utilized in very early pregnancy. Ultrasound makers have to do with the dimension of a grocery store cart.
